Willing to contribute our share to a better and more sustainable world, we, Bart Baesens and Tim Verdonck, founded BlueCourses on August 10th, 2019. Bart Baesens is a professor of Data Science at KU Leuven. He co-authored more than 250 scientific papers and 10 books.
Furthermore, listed in the top 2% of Stanford University’s new Database of Top Scientists in the World. And named one of the World’s top educators in Data Science by CDO magazine in 2021. Tim Verdonck is a professor at KU Leuven and the University of Antwerp. He co-authored more than 50 papers on topics related to analytics, statistics, and robust modeling.

The missing statement of BlueCourses is twofold.
Firstly, we would like to disseminate knowledge by offering on-line courses on Business Analytics and its applications in Fraud, Credit Risk, Marketing, Text analysis, etc. All of the courses are delivered by internationally recognized professors in the field.
They provide a sound mix of theoretical concepts and methods combined with practical insights and case studies.

Our second goal is to contribute our share in cleaning up our precious oceans from plastic.
Hence, we invest at least 20% of our EBIT (Earnings Before Interest and Taxes) to companies cleaning up our oceans from plastic.
Since its founding, BlueCourses is offering 20 courses on topics such as Machine Learning essentials, Fraud Analytics, Credit Risk Modeling, Deep Learning, Text Analytics, Ethics & AI, Customer Lifetime Value Modeling, Quantum Machine Learning, Web Scraping, Geospatial analytics and Recommender Systems.
One of our most recent and most popular courses is a course on Fundamentals of Climate Risk Management which discusses Climate Change, Climate Risk Management, Carbon Net Strategies, Climate Disclosures and Stress Testing. Each course consists of recorded videos which the customer can see an unlimited number of times during one year.

All BlueCourses courses provide a sound mix of both theoretical and technical insights, as well as practical implementation details and guidance.
Illustrated by several real-life case studies and examples. All courses also feature code examples in R, Python and SAS with accompanying tutorials for newcomers in the field.
To optimize the learning experience, the courses become interactively designed with multiple choice questions and discussions. Certificates are provided upon course completion and can be easily posted on LinkedIn or other social media. Throughout each course, the instructors also extensively report upon their research and industry experience.
At BlueCourses, we are proud to have accumulated a substantial customer portfolio with customers such as banks (e.g., HSBC, Deutsche bank, Santander), consulting firms (e.g. PwC, EY), (on-line) retailers, Telco providers, insurers, regulators, universities (e.g., IESEG), etc.
